MAGAZINES

 
   
 

 

In occasion of the yearly Culture Weeks promoted by the Ministero per i Beni e le Attività Culturali, the Soprintendenza has published a tabloid format magazine illustrating all the restorations carried out between 1987 and 2001 all over the territory under tutelage.Two magazines included also monographic inserts:

-         La collezione del Museo statuario. Rilievi greci dall’età classica all’epoca romana (2000).

-         Museo di Palazzo Ducale – Mantova: Le grandi pale d’altare nella Galleria Nuova (2001)

 
     
   

CATALOGUES

 
   

LE COLLEZIONI DI PALAZZO DUCALE  
   
 

From 2000 on has begun the systematic publication of scientific catalogues of the art works of the Museum. The project is the concrete outcome of an agreement subscribed on 24th January 2000 between the Ministry and the Major of Mantua; because of that the Soprintendenza has engaged itself in the valorisation of the art works of the Town Hall in deposit in the Palace from 1915.

The series, called Le collezioni di Palazzo Ducale, is directed by Giuliana Algeri, Superintendent for Historical and Artistic Goods for the provinces of Brescia, Cremona and Mantova, and Director of the Ducal Palace of Mantova. 

The first volume, I Marmi Antichi. Rilievi greci e neoattici, edited by Federico Rausa, has been published in September 2000 by Tre Lune ed. and illustrates the marbles exposed in the Rustica Apartment.

The second volume, I Dipinti della Galleria Nuova, edited by Giovanni Rodella, has been published in 2002 by Tre Lune ed. and illustrates the altarpieces exposed in the New Gallery.

A third volume, concerning the marbles recently (2002) restored and placed in the Exhibition Gallery, and a fourth one, illustrating the paintings exposed from August 2002 in the St. Barbara Gallery, are to be published soon.

 A new guide of the Ducal Palace (Il Palazzo Ducale di Mantova) has also been edited in 2002, by Stefano L’Occaso, and published in four languages (English, French, German and Italian) by Electa ed.; a shorter version of the same product is in preparation by the same author.

 
     
 

VIDEO

 
  VIDEO OF THE DUCAL PALACE  
  A video about 20 minutes long, illustraty the history of the Ducal Palace of Mantua, has been edited by the Soprintendenza, with texts by Stefano L' Occaso and Marta Ragozzino. The video includes aerial, outdoor and indoor filmtaking and explains the architectural growth and decoration of the huge complex.
